Kapil Sibal launches school sanitation website

Times of India
NEW DELHI: HRD minister (HRD) Kapil Sibal on Thursday launched a website to give National School Sanitation Ratings, which will recognise the schools taking significant steps towards effective sanitation, a statement said.

Giving out ideas to improve sanitation in schools, Sibal suggested to mark one day every week as the day for teachers and staff to use student's toilets.

"The minister suggested that staff toilets in schools should be closed for at least one day in a week and all the teachers should use the toilets meant for students so that they are appreciative of the state of toilets used by students," an HRD ministry official said.

The ratings would also give national recognition to those schools which are taking significant steps towards effective sanitation and improvement in service delivery.

In furtherance of the National School Sanitation Initiative, all the Central Board of Secondary Education (CBSE) schools will be rated according to their sanitation status in five colour categories.
